What if you drift it without using the handbrake i.e. Just pressing the accelerator and turning aggressively then holding the drift? What components does that wear out the most? And does it affect the handbrake still if you're not even using it for the drift?
I'm pretty sure most E9x's except for M3's and tuned 335i's don't really have enough power to do that without having a wet surface and/or garbage tires. It's also basically impossible if you have an open diff. However, it would wear out the diff, could stress things like CV joints and driveshafts. Probably not the best for the transmission either. Generally, sliding a car is not great for longevity of parts. If you aren't using the handbrake, then you won't wear it out.
